The Super League 1 match on December 21, 2023, between Panserraikos and AEK Athens displayed a fiercely competitive display of talent, tactics, and no shortage of on-field drama. Both teams showcased their abilities, ending an intense battle with a fair 2-2 draw.
From the onset, AEK Athens demonstrated a more aggressive approach, notching up the first two goals within the first half at 00:15:28 and 00:45:15 respectively. This lead placed them in a strong position going into the second half, which could have influenced bettors favoring them. Yet, Panserraikos displayed tactical resilience by clawing back a goal three minutes before halftime at 00:39:05.
This narrative of resilience was furthered when Panserraikos managed to pull another goal back in the second half at 01:33:38, leveling the score to 2-2. This comeback gives insights regarding the strength and determination of Panserraikos, offering football bettors valuable cues for future matches involving this team.
In addition to goals scored, the significant number of yellow cards issued proved to be another influential factor in this game. Panserraikos racked up five yellow cards, with three in the first half and two in the second half, which eventually led to a red card – reducing the team to 10 men. Meanwhile, AEK Athens' discipline record wasn't squeaky clean either, receiving four yellow cards, all in the second half.
The high number of yellow cards, especially in key periods of the game, could have potentially disrupted the flow and tactics of both teams. Besides, reducing Panserraikos to ten men could have given AEK Athens an advantage, which did not change the outcome of the match. However, the disciplined nature of the game is a crucial factor for bettors to consider in future games.
A total of 8 corner kicks were taken during the match, with Panserraikos outperforming AEK Athens by 2, leading 5 to 3. Although these didn't translate directly to goals, they do indicate a more aggressive stance and attacking strategy adopted by Panserraikos. Usually, corner kicks lead to scoring opportunities, and having a higher number could indicate a team's offensive strength, which would be useful for bettors.
In conclusion, while AEK Athens started off stronger and took the lead, Panserraikos' determination and relentless attacks led to the final 2-2 scoreline. The number of cards issued played a significant role in the match unfolding the way it did, influencing both teams' tactics and approach.
